Transaction 5707dbc40096ce907a5cafbb472c38e0719fc23afbc32f3bc7b651fec1ac2e6d

1 Input
1 Outputs
  • 5707dbc40096ce907a5cafbb472c38e0719fc23afbc32f3bc7b651fec1ac2e6d:0
  • value  2237773
    address  3MK45RV25m8EgPYBxHoDc2ejuy6dxFENP3